Increases the value of your home

Double glazed windows are made consisting of two glass panes that are hermetically sealed. They are also referred to as Insulated glass units (IGUs), and are typically made from laminated or tempered glass. The space between the two panes are usually filled with air or argon gas, which are both known for their insulating properties.

Prevents condensation

Condensation on windows happens when the air cools and moisture develops. This is a natural process which is common in all areas of your home. It's also more common during the spring and summer when humidity is high. While condensation can be unpleasant but it's not always a bad thing. It can also enhance the energy efficiency of your home.

Condensation in double-glazed windows is an indication that the seal on the insulated glass unit (IGU) has failed. Fortunately, you don't need to replace the entire window to fix this issue. A technician will make tiny holes on the top of the window and on the bottom to allow the moisture to go away. This will remove the foggy windows as well as any magnesium or calcium deposits.

Once the moisture is gone, a specialist will apply an anti-fog treatment to the window. This coating will prevent future moisture build-up on the windows. To reduce condensation, make sure that your bathroom and kitchen have adequate ventilation.

Over time, the seals on windows that are insulated may fail due to a number of reasons. These include a lack of ventilation or exposure to sunlight for a long time and the expansion and movement of the frame and sash due to seasonal changes in the weather. Seals on the southern and western sides of a house are more susceptible to fail. However, you can avoid damaged window seals by observing some simple maintenance tips. For instance, it's best to avoid applying reflective window films to windows with insulation as they may harm the seals.

Prevents noise

Noise pollution is a common problem that can affect the quality of your life. It can affect your sleep patterns and lead to a variety of health problems. double glazed units near me glazing can help to reduce the noise outside your home. This will stop you from being irritated by the sound of traffic, planes, or even your noisy neighbour's leaf blower.

While a single pane of glass can provide a solid block against noise double or triple glazing can significantly enhance the performance of your windows by making them quieter. The air gap between the two panes of the window is a major contributor to its performance. The size of the gap as well as the thickness of the pane will impact the acoustic performance of the window. The greater the gap, the better the sound will be blocked.

Another method to improve the acoustic quality of your double-glazed windows is by adding an acoustic coating to the inside of the glass.
